At a glance

Dimension Opticians, Dispensing Endoscopy Technicians
Median pay $46,560 $46,050
Employment 79,690 103,650
Employment outlook (2024–34) · BLS projection About average (+2.9%) About average (+3.5%)
Annual openings · BLS projection 6,800 14,400
Typical education · O*NET Most occupations in this zone require training in vocational schools, related on-the-job experience, or an associate's degree. Usually requires a high school diploma or GED, though some occupations may not.
AI exposure · published exposure studies Moderate · 44th pct Low · 12th pct
Global GenAI gradient · ILO ISCO-08 · via crosswalk 44th pct · 24% of tasks 43rd pct · 23% of tasks
Observed AI use · Anthropic Economic Index
Mostly remote-capable · Dingel–Neiman No No

Pay and employment are BLS OEWS estimates; outlook and openings are BLS 2024–2034 projections; AI exposure and observed-use figures come from separate research and reflect exposure and usage, not predictions that either job will disappear. Compare like with like.

Skills

Shared: Customer and Personal Service, Speaking, Oral Comprehension, Oral Expression, Active Listening, Near Vision, Production and Processing, Reading Comprehension, Written Comprehension, Speech Recognition, Speech Clarity, English Language, Written Expression, Problem Sensitivity, Deductive Reasoning, Critical Thinking, Service Orientation, Education and Training, Information Ordering, Finger Dexterity, Writing, Social Perceptiveness, Coordination, Category Flexibility, Arm-Hand Steadiness, Computers and Electronics, Active Learning, Monitoring, Complex Problem Solving, Judgment and Decision Making, Time Management, Inductive Reasoning.

Specific to Opticians, Dispensing

  • Sales and Marketing
  • Mathematics
  • Administrative
  • Administration and Management
  • Persuasion
  • Psychology
  • Law and Government
  • Personnel and Human Resources

Specific to Endoscopy Technicians

  • Medicine and Dentistry
  • Manual Dexterity
  • Operations Monitoring
  • Selective Attention
  • Control Precision
  • Instructing
  • Operation and Control
  • Flexibility of Closure

Knowledge, skills & abilities O*NET rates as important for each occupation. “Shared” are common to both; the columns list what is distinctive to each (top by the order O*NET surfaces).
